Abstract

Fruits defence mechamisms are constituted by enzymes and chemical groups, that are capable of inhibiting free radicals effects and promote benefits to human health. Tomatoes (Solanum lycopersicum) are good sources of bioactive compounds, whose effects are originated from the antioxidant activity of carotenoids (lycopene and β-carotene), phenolic acids, flavonoids and ascorbic acid. This study paired commercial tomato samples phenolic compounds profiles with their antioxidant activity using multivariate analysis to highlight the phenolic compounds most responsible for antioxidant benefits. Tomatoes varieties Khaki, Cherry, Italian and Long Life were collected in Rio Grande (Brazil) local retail. Samples maturation stage standardization was performed by analysis of colour, pH and sugar/acid ratio, following lyophilization until the analysis. The phenolic compounds were extracted with 80% ethanol and their phenolic acid and flavonoid profile were determined by HPLC-DAD. The antioxidant activity of the extracts were assessed by the DPPH, ABTS and OH radical scavenging methods. The results showed that the variety Khaki had the highest phenolic content (42.5 mg.g-1). Cherry tomato samples stood out as the highest sources of caffeic acid (104.7 μg.g-1), chlorogenic (575.1 μg.g-1) and catechin (548.8 μg.g-1). The phenolic extracts were good inhibitors of antioxidant activity, particularly the extracts from Khaki tomatoes, which inhibited 80% DPPH and ABTS radicals. PCA showed that protocatechuic acid explained well the extracts antioxidant activity. Therefore, Khaki and Cherry varieties are the best sources of functional compounds among those that impact the trade and human diet.
